Summary
Voyager Technologies is a Denver-based defense-technology and space-infrastructure company best known for leading Starlab, the international joint venture building a commercial successor to the International Space Station. Founded in October 2019 by Dylan Taylor as Voyager Space Holdings, the company grew by rolling up twelve space and defense firms — including Altius Space Machines and Pioneer Astronautics (2020), The Launch Company, Valley Tech Systems and Nanoracks (2021), Space Micro (2022), ZIN Technologies (2023), and Estes Energetics, ExoTerra Resource and LEOcloud (2025). Through Nanoracks it owns the Bishop Airlock, the first and only permanent commercial module on the ISS, operating since December 2020. Starlab won a $160M NASA Commercial LEO Destinations award in December 2021 (later raised to $217.5M) and evolved into Starlab Space LLC, a US-led JV with Airbus, Mitsubishi Corporation and MDA Space, with Palantir supplying station software, Hilton designing crew quarters and Northrop Grumman providing Cygnus resupply. The single-launch, 8-meter-class station — with roughly half the ISS's pressurized volume — is contracted to fly on SpaceX's Starship, now targeted for 2029, and completed its Commercial Critical Design Review with NASA in February 2026, clearing the way for flight manufacturing. Voyager rebranded to Voyager Technologies in early 2025 to emphasize national security and went public on NYSE in June 2025, raising $382.8M and briefly touching a ~$3.8B valuation. Its Defense & National Security segment — solid and electric propulsion, energetics, signals intelligence and communications — is its fastest-growing business and put it on the Anduril-led team named among the Space Force's Golden Dome space-based-interceptor awardees in April 2026. In June 2026 it agreed to acquire lunar-lander developer Astrobotic for up to $300M. As of July 2026 Voyager trades near a $1.85B market cap, posted $166.4M of 2025 revenue (net loss $116.1M), guides to $230–255M for 2026 on a record $275.3M backlog, and awaits NASA's CLD Phase 2 competition, whose draft RFP was released July 7, 2026.

Next-generation commercial space station developed by Starlab Space, the Voyager-led JV with Airbus, Mitsubishi Corporation and MDA Space. The ~8-meter-diameter, two-deck station launches complete in a single SpaceX Starship flight — no on-orbit assembly — and hosts a continuous crew of four with ISS-equivalent payload capability, an MDA SKYMAKER robotic arm, Palantir-built AI/data infrastructure and Hilton-designed crew quarters. Completed NASA Commercial Critical Design Review in February 2026; targeting a 2029 launch.

The first and only permanent commercially owned module on the International Space Station, built by Nanoracks (now Voyager) with Thales Alenia Space and Boeing. The bell-shaped, ~4 m³ airlock — five times the capacity of the station's government airlock — deploys CubeSats and external payloads, hosts experiments and ejects trash, and has operated since its December 2020 arrival on SpaceX CRS-21.

What's Next
NASA released the Phase 2 draft RFP on July 7, 2026 (industry feedback due July 27) and plans at least two early development contracts for commercial space stations before a later down-select, with the award expected in spring 2027. Winning is the pivotal catalyst for Starlab's multi-billion-dollar opportunity.
Close the Astrobotic acquisition
The up-to-$300M acquisition of lunar-lander maker Astrobotic (announced June 2, 2026) was expected to close by early July 2026 pending regulatory approvals, turning Voyager into an end-to-end lunar infrastructure provider. Watch for the closing announcement and integration plan.
Move Starlab into flight-hardware manufacturing
Following the February 2026 Commercial Critical Design Review — the 28th NASA milestone — Starlab transitions from design validation to manufacturing, fabrication, testing and assembly of the flight station. Watch for structural test article and long-lead hardware milestones.

Operations & Revenue
As of July 2026 Voyager trades on the NYSE (~$1.85B market cap) with three segments: Defense & National Security (its growth engine, up 63% in Q4 2025 and boosted by Golden Dome interceptor work with Anduril), Space Solutions (Bishop Airlock ISS services, in-space propulsion, space science), and Starlab. The company is unprofitable — Q1 2026 revenue of $35.2M came with a $44.0M net loss — but holds a record $275.3M backlog, raised 2026 guidance to $230–255M, and closed 2025 with over $700M of liquidity. Starlab completed its Commercial Critical Design Review in February 2026 and is moving toward flight manufacturing while NASA's CLD Phase 2 draft RFP (released July 7, 2026) sets up the decisive station competition; the Astrobotic acquisition announced June 2026 adds lunar landers to the portfolio.

Timeline
On February 23, 2026 Starlab completes its Commercial Critical Design Review with NASA — the 28th milestone under its Space Act Agreement — confirming the design is mature and executable and marking the transition from design to manufacturing, fabrication, testing and assembly.
On April 24, 2026 the Space Force reveals up to $3.2B in contracts to 12 companies to develop Golden Dome space-based interceptors. Voyager participates on the Anduril-led team alongside Impulse Space and K2 Space, contributing energetics, propulsion, and digital avionics and communications technologies.
On June 2, 2026 Voyager announces the acquisition of Pittsburgh lunar-lander company Astrobotic Technology — $162M in cash and stock plus up to $129M in earnouts and $9M of assumed debt — expanding into commercial lunar delivery and lunar power. The deal was expected to close by early July 2026.
After pausing the Phase 2 acquisition in January 2026 to revisit requirements, NASA releases a draft request for proposals on July 7, 2026, planning at least two early development contracts for commercial space stations. Industry feedback is due July 27, positioning Starlab for the decisive ISS-replacement competition.
The Voyager-Airbus JV Starlab Space LLC closes on January 9, 2024, and NASA adds $57.5M to the Space Act Agreement (total $217.5M) on January 5. On January 31 Starlab books SpaceX's Starship to launch the entire station in a single flight.
Mitsubishi Corporation joins the Starlab joint venture as an equity owner in April 2024, followed by Canada's MDA Space on May 29, 2024, which contributes SKYMAKER robotic arms and external robotics. Palantir (station software/AI, February 2024), Hilton (crew quarters, 2022) and Northrop Grumman (Cygnus resupply, 2023) round out the partner network.
Airbus Defence and Space joins the Starlab program in January 2023, replacing Lockheed Martin and shifting the design from inflatable to a rigid metallic 8-meter-class module. Voyager and Airbus formalize a joint venture agreement in August 2023 after passing NASA's Systems Requirements Review in June.
Voyager acquires a majority stake in X.O. Markets, parent of ISS-services leader Nanoracks, in May 2021 — its marquee acquisition among twelve since 2019, including Altius Space Machines and Pioneer (2020), The Launch Company and Valley Tech Systems (2021), Space Micro (2022) and ZIN Technologies (2023).
In December 2021 NASA selects the Nanoracks/Voyager-led Starlab team for a $160M Commercial LEO Destinations Space Act Agreement — the largest of three awards, ahead of Blue Origin's Orbital Reef ($130M) and Northrop Grumman ($125.6M). Starlab is proposed as a free-flying successor to the ISS.
The Nanoracks Bishop Airlock, the first permanent commercial module on the International Space Station, launches on SpaceX CRS-21 on December 6, 2020 and is berthed to the Tranquility module on December 19. Voyager acquires Bishop's owner Nanoracks the following year.
